BAPE Releases Lookbook and Product Shots for New Coach Collab Collection

The collection will be available starting Feb. 22.

With their new collab collection, BAPE and Coach aimed for "bold and playful" pieces that play to the aesthetics of their respective hometowns of Tokyo and New York City.

The collection spans leather goods and ready-to-wear pieces and is billed as "a fusion of the established codes of both brands." Notable inclusions are a version of Coach's signature pattern blended with the BAPE ape head logo—utilized with camo, khaki, and rainbow jacquard—and a down leather puffer. 

Fans can also look forward to footwear, backpacks, and tees. The collection will be available starting Feb. 22 at A Bathing Ape stores and the brand’s online shop.
